IYC Demands Probe Of Student’s Killing By Vigilante

by Felix Igbekoyi
4 months ago
in News
Share on WhatsAppShare on FacebookShare on XTelegram

Ijaw Youth Council (IYC), Western Zone, has called on the Delta State government and security agencies to unmask the reasons behind the murder of a student of Ogwashi-Uku Polytechnic, Delta State, Peter Eyorowalebo.

Advertisement

A member of the Vigilante Group of Nigeria (VGN), in Ogwashi-Uku, Delta State, allegedly shot and killed him on Thursday morning, though he has been arrested.

The suspect, Peter Ike, has been transferred to the State Criminal Investigation Department on the orders of the State Commissioner of Police, Olufemi Abaniwonda, for discreet investigation.

The 29-year-old part-time student of Science and Laboratory Technology was killed in his room while reading and preparing for exams that same day.

According to a statement by the command’s spokesman, SP Bright Edafe, Commissioner Abaniwonda ordered the Deputy Commissioner of Police, State Criminal Investigation Department, to take over the case and ensure that a thorough investigation is carried out.

While condoling with the family of the deceased and students of the Polytechnic, the police boss advised them to remain calm, assuring that no stone would be left unturned in the pursuit of justice.

Reports indicate that the vigilante member had entered the deceased’s room while fidgeting with a loaded gun, which accidentally discharged, striking the student in the face and killing him on the spot.

The Divisional Police Officer in Ogwashi-Uku was said to have swiftly mobilised to the scene and found the victim in a pool of blood.

The deceased was taken to the hospital where he was confirmed dead by the doctor on duty. His body has been deposited at the mortuary for autopsy.

Meanwhile, the information officer of IYC, Tare Magbei, expressed sadness over the incident, insisting that the young man should not die untimely and be forgotten like that.
